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 19133

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en 19133?

Actualmente hay 18 Apartamentos Estudios en 19133 con alquileres que van desde $700 hasta $1,679, con un precio medio de $1,352.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 19133?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 19133 varian entre $599 y $2,751 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,505

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 19133?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 19133 van desde $1,000 hasta $3,083.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,740

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 19133?

En estos momentos hay 28 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 19133 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,350 y $2,100 - con una media de $1,783 para el lugar.
